In the volatile landscape of 1950s Latin America, a charismatic Argentine doctor named Ernesto Guevara Benicio Del Toro is transformed by a continent in turmoil. Directed by Steven Soderbergh, this sweeping drama charts Guevara's fateful motorcycle journey across South America with his friend Alberto Granado Rodrigo Santoro, an expedition that opens his eyes to deep-seated poverty and injustice. The experience ignites a revolutionary fire within the young man, setting him on a collision course with history that will eventually lead him to a meeting with the exiled Cuban lawyer Fidel Castro Demian Bichir. As Guevara evolves from an idealistic traveler into the iconic figure known as Che, the film immerses viewers in the gritty, visceral atmosphere of political awakening and armed struggle, exploring the personal sacrifices and unwavering convictions that forge a legend.
